蒲荷读音
荷蒲编程——初学者进阶指南
荷蒲编程,又称为莲花编程,是一种基于荷蒲(莲花)图的编程方法。相较于传统的编程方法,荷蒲编程更注重问题的可视化和模块化,能够提高编程效率和质量。本文将从初学者进阶的角度,介绍荷蒲编程的基本概念,常用工具和技巧,以及编程实践中应注意的问题。
一、基本概念
荷蒲编程的基本图形为荷蒲图,它是一个由圆形和直线组成的图形。荷蒲图中的圆形表示问题的状态,而直线则表示问题的转移条件和转移结果。荷蒲图通常用于建立状态转移模型,用于解决逻辑或算法性的问题。荷蒲编程的核心思想就是将荷蒲图转化为计算机程序,以实现问题的自动求解。
在荷蒲编程中,有两个基本的运算符:交和并。交运算符表示同时满足两个条件,而并运算符则表示两个条件中任意一个成立。例如,对于状态A,如果它既能够转移到状态B,又能够转移到状态C,那么表示为A交B并C。
二、常用工具和技巧
荷蒲编程的实现有多种工具和技巧。常见的有:
1. 荷蒲编程语言。荷蒲编程语言是专门为荷蒲编程而设计的一种编程语言。荷蒲编程语言拥有丰富的荷蒲编程语法和库函数,能够方便地实现荷蒲图到计算机程序的转化。

2. 递归函数。递归函数是荷蒲编程的重要技巧之一。通过递归函数,可以方便地处理荷蒲图中的状态转移关系,从而实现荷蒲图到计算机程序的转化。
3. 软件工具。荷蒲编程常用的软件工具有荷蒲图绘制工具、荷蒲编程IDE等。荷蒲图绘制工具可以帮助用户绘制荷蒲图,荷蒲编程IDE则可以方便地编写、调试荷蒲编程程序。
三、问题解答实践中的注意事项
在进行荷蒲编程的实践中,需要注意以下几点:
1. 分析问题。荷蒲编程要求将问题抽象为状态和状态转移关系,因此在实践中需要深入分析问题,找出其本质。
2. 设计荷蒲图。根据分析得到的问题本质,设计荷蒲图。良好的荷蒲图设计可以减少程序实现的难度和复杂程度。
3. 递归实现。在实现荷蒲编程程序时,尽可能使用递归函数进行实现。递归函数能够方便地表达荷蒲图中的状态转移关系,使程序代码更加简洁、清晰。
4. 历史问题。荷蒲编程要求处理状态转移关系,因此在设计荷蒲图时需要考虑历史问题。如果不考虑历史问题,很容易出现死循环等问题。
荷蒲编程是一种不同于常规编程方法的代码实现方式。在进行荷蒲编程时,需要掌握其基本概念和常用工具和技巧,同时要注意在编程实践中的一些问题。相信本文的介绍能够帮助初学者更好地了解和掌握荷蒲编程。
本文 新鼎系統网 原创,转载保留链接!网址:https://acs-product.com/post/7587.html
免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!联系QQ:2760375052 版权所有:新鼎系統网沪ICP备2023024866号-15